>I've never seen such things in Ubuntu, and I use hoary.  However I've
>seen similar things in my Debian sid box (the whole archive, main,
>labelled as unauthenticated), and I use aptitude.  That problem was
>solved by an "aptitude update" later.
>
>So I am suspecting this is due to some mirror or network problem,
>either the content and the Release/Packages file on the mirror are out
>of sync, or some file fetching from the mirror simply failed (which I
>suspect is my case, as I use FTP and occasionally have connection
>problems).
>
>So my question is: are the people experiencing this problem using hoary
>or breezy?

I'm using Hoary and I see it regularly for packages both in main and in
universe/multiverse, as well as for security. What's most worrying is
that I'm so used to it that I hardly think before hitting 'y'... :(
